The hair on the body of a newborn Pomeranian is thin and short. Within a few months, the coat will grow rapidly. Generally, at the age of 3 months, the Pomeranian begins to enter the moulting period.
In addition to the long period of shedding during puppyhood (which can range from 3 months to 6-8 months), Pomeranians also need to adapt to climate changes when the spring and autumn seasons change every year. Pomeranians also shed their hair. Generally speaking, adult Pomeranians have the best hair texture. Generally around the age of 3, the quality of Pomeranian hair will reach its peak.
Many parents will trim their Pomeranian’s hair twice during the period of shedding. In the hot summer, the hair can be trimmed thinner.
